Activating your subscription
Note
If you have not yet inserted your smart card, insert it the correct way round now (see page 10).
If you do not have a smart card, but you wish to view premium services, contact Viasat to obtain
a smart card.
Once your set-top box has found the satellite channels, the Subscription Activation
screen appears.
1. To activate your subscription, follow the instructions that are given on the
screen.
2. When the subscription activation is complete, press
OK.
Switching on and off
Whenever you are not using your set-top box you should put it into standby. You
should not unplug it at the mains socket.
To put your set-top box into standby, press S.
To take your set-top box out of standby, press S.
